Jalebi Recipe | How to Make Jalebi at Home Easily
Easy Jalebi Recipe with step by step pictures. Jalebi is a deep fried Indian sweet which is then drenched in sweet sugar syrup. It taste more or like honeycomb.

Ingredients
1x
2x
3x
▢
All purpose flour / Maida - 100 gm
▢
Curds / Yoghurt - 1 cup
▢
Lime juice - 1 tsp
▢
Cornstarch / Cornflour- 30 gm
▢
Hot oil - 1 tbsp
▢
saffron color/food colouring-1 tsp
▢
Sugar - 1 cup
▢
Water - ½ cup
▢
Oil for deep frying
Instructions
▢
Mix flour, cornflour, lime juice, curd, food colouring till it forms a thick batter.
▢
Heat oil and pour hot oil over this and mix well. Let this ferment overnight.
▢
Heat sugar and water in a sauce pan for 5 mins till it gets transparent and syrupy consistency.
▢
Heat oil for deep frying.
▢
Now take the jalebi batter and spoon it in the piping bag and pipe it in hot oil.
▢
Fry it till crisp and light golden. Put this in hot sugar syrup and let it sit for 30 sec.
▢
Take it out and serve hot with some milk.
